About The Kooks
Formed in Brighton in 2002, The Kooks swiftly rose to prominence on the back of their debut album, 'Inside In/Inside Out', a record that became a touchstone for a generation of indie music fans. Their career journey has been marked by consistent evolution and a dedication to their signature sound, captivating audiences worldwide with their infectious blend of catchy melodies, witty lyricism, and undeniable charm. Over the years, they have solidified their reputation as one of the UK's most beloved and enduring live acts, consistently delivering performances that resonate deeply with their devoted fanbase.
The Kooks' signature musical style is a vibrant tapestry woven with elements of indie rock, pop, and a touch of melodic punk. Frontman Luke Pritchard's distinctive vocal delivery, coupled with the band's knack for crafting anthemic choruses and intricate guitar riffs, has defined their sound. Notable achievements include multiple chart-topping albums, platinum-selling singles, and sold-out tours across the globe. Their ability to blend introspective lyrics with upbeat, danceable rhythms has earned them critical acclaim and a loyal following that spans continents.

Getting to Piece Hall Halifax
The Piece Hall Halifax is easily accessible by public transport, making it a convenient destination for concertgoers. The nearest major train station is Halifax Station, which is well-connected to cities across the North of England, including Leeds, Manchester, and Bradford. From Halifax Station, the Piece Hall is a pleasant and short walk of approximately 5-10 minutes. Numerous bus routes also serve the town centre, with stops located within easy walking distance of the venue.
